Participants were given the freedom to explore the painting process while being guided by resident artists.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The mural was sketched onto the vinyl canvas by Lee Ball and Tunde Afolayan prior to the event and color maps were on hand to aid the painters. At first some people were hesitant saying, “We don’t want to mess up the mural!”. However, they quickly learned an important fact about the creative process: there is no such thing as “messing up”. Happy accidents become a part of the creative experience. Within a few hours, brush strokes, splashes of color, movement of lines, and textures began to come alive.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;It was a great day as more than 60 individuals, including children, families, artists, local politicians, and passers-by, participated in the exciting, fun-filled creative experience. The mural measuring eight by twelve feet was complete within eight hours. The finished mural will be installed on an exterior wall of the Carter Building. &lt;br /&gt;Rick Bennett, a Carter Building Resident Artist characterized the experience: “What an amazing day at the Carter Building! You could feel the creative energy in the air. Everyone participating had so much fun. The mural is fun, colorful and captures the story of the Carter Building Community. Her childhood home was located in the middle of a cotton field,&amp;nbsp;the early childhood experience of of the cotton field&amp;nbsp;is reflected in her work. She also worked in the tobacco mill during her early years. She started painting at age eleven in the fifth grade, with the direction and encouragement of her special teacher, Mrs. Anna Wall Johnson at Ashley Chapel Elementary School. While at elementary school, she had a privilege of doing bulletin boards, floats, and some other projects that were available. Mrs. Johnson often said to young Lula “Stick with it, and one day it will serve you well.” &l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-family: Calibri;"&gt;For a period of approximately five to six years, her art&lt;br /&gt;took a slight detour, when she pursued a career in modeling with the Greensboro&lt;br /&gt;based Glamour Inc. &lt;span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/span&gt;Lula was blessed with two loving children, Cynthia and Jack Jr. when they became teenagers, Lula’s painting resumed at a rapid pace. margin:0px auto 10px; text-align:center;cursor:pointer; cursor:hand;width: 300px; height: 400px;" src="http://3.bp.blogspot.com/_O2V6bqSX41Y/SuH9uTfumgI/AAAAAAAAAFU/e0xWdqsMZ_4/s400/decSHOW.jpg" border="0" alt=""id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5395872800515725826"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Artist’s Statement&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;This new body of work represents my direct response to creative urges,&lt;br /&gt;inspired by sounds and movements. I attempt to explore the powerful&lt;br /&gt;elements in performing arts, hoping to create a visual poetry imbued with&lt;br /&gt;the visual elements of space, color and texture. The need to capture the&lt;br /&gt;essence of the spiritual celebration of life in various dance forms,&lt;br /&gt;creative movements, and energetic sounds influenced the direction of this&lt;br /&gt;current work. In other words, my experimentation with movements and&lt;br /&gt;sounds has given birth to a visual celebration of human spirits and souls&lt;br /&gt;beyond the physical realm.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;My excitement and fervor to capture the vitality and spontaneity of movement has&lt;br /&gt;prompted me to engage in the process of freely expressing my subjective interpretation of performing art forms. The seemingly dominant element of&lt;br /&gt;color becomes an available template for me to facilitate the nuances of&lt;br /&gt;the visual poetry.&lt;br /&gt;My intent is to take the viewer to a certain domain where they can see the sounds and feel the movements through my work. He is a graduate of the prestigious Yaba College of Technology 'Yaba School' Lagos-Nigeria and University of Missouri-Columbia; MO.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Exploring color as the basis of painting, Tunde infuses spiritualism and symbolism in his powerful lyrical expressions. His thematic compositions captured in vibrant colors allow figurative images to adopt expressive, abstract qualities as well as representational styles. Tunde’s spontaneous, energetic gestures created splashes, strokes, and heavily layered areas that reveal the confident control of his painting media for clarity of expressions. His color pallet tempered with strong and vibrant hues exemplifies his powerful traditional African roots and aesthetics.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Tunde’s paintings are held in private and corporate collections throughout the world. L. Trigg Community School in Elizabeth City North Carolina . The concept was inspired by the history of "The Great Dismal Swamp" and its connection to the &lt;em&gt;'Underground Railroad'&lt;/em&gt;. The students went on a field trip to explore the historic Dismal Swamp as part of the Underground Railroad Path to Freedom experience.
